Additional SEC filing notes
Footnote F1
This Form 4 is filed jointly by Impactive Capital LP ("Impactive Capital"), Impactive Capital LLC ("Impactive GP"), Christian Asmar and Lauren Taylor Wolfe (collectively, the "Reporting Persons"). Each of the Reporting Persons disclaims beneficial ownership of the securities reported herein except to the extent of her, his or its pecuniary interest therein.
Footnote F2
Restricted Stock Units ("RSUs") will vest in total on May 14, 2027.
Footnote F3
Because Ms. Wolfe serves on the board of directors (the "Board") of WEX Inc. (the "Issuer") as a representative of Impactive Capital and its affiliates, Impactive Capital is entitled to receive the direct economic interest in securities granted to Ms. Wolfe by the Issuer in respect of Ms. Wolfe's Board position. Ms. Wolfe disclaims beneficial ownership of the Issuer's securities to which this report relates and at no time has Ms. Wolfe had any economic interest in such securities except any indirect economic interest through Impactive Capital and its affiliates.
SEC remarks
Lauren Taylor Wolfe, Managing Member of Impactive Capital LLC, the general partner of Impactive Capital LP, is a director of the Issuer. For purposes of Section 16 of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, as amended, the Reporting Persons are deemed directors by deputization by virtue of their representation on the Board of Directors of the Issuer.
